Tom Jones thrilled fans of all ages with a thrilling performance in Malta on Tuesday night.
The 84-year-old Welsh singer opened the show with a folk song despite his age I am getting oldera rather ironic choice for this once dynamic performer.
Returning to Malta after 15 years, the legendary artist put on a fantastic show at MFCC in Ta’ Qali, performing many of his greatest hits including Sexy bomb arrive This is not surprising.
But it is a timeless classic Delilah The audience began to rise to their feet with great enthusiasm, and the excitement of the performance continued from that point on.
Jones and his band thrilled the audience at Ta’ Qali. Photo: Chris Sant FournierEvery song in the concert, presented by NnG Promotions and Greatt, received loud cheers and applause from the crowd of about 5,000 people.
Jones peppered celebrity references throughout his set, reminiscing about the night he went to see Chuck Berry perform with Elvis Presley, while reminding the crowd that he is the record holder for the oldest person to have a No. 1 album in the UK.
The multi-award-winning singer sang several of her hits and ended the show with the classic Big FireballThe Last Hurrah confirms his lasting impact on the music world.
Before the show ended, he told the audience: “We still have a lot of fun, right? We plan on traveling around the world a lot more.”
Audiences spanning at least two generations agreed.
